Subject: [RFCv5 01/16] Bluetooth: trivial: Fix long line
Date: Fri, 17 Feb 2012 15:43:57 +0200	[thread overview]
Message-ID: <1329486252-25252-2-git-send-email-Andrei.Emeltchenko.news@gmail.com> (raw)
In-Reply-To: <1329486252-25252-1-git-send-email-Andrei.Emeltchenko.news@gmail.com>

From: Andrei Emeltchenko <andrei.emeltchenko@intel.com>

Signed-off-by: Andrei Emeltchenko <andrei.emeltchenko@intel.com>
Acked-by: Marcel Holtmann <marcel@holtmann.org>
---
 net/bluetooth/l2cap_core.c |    3 ++-
 1 files changed, 2 insertions(+), 1 deletions(-)

diff --git a/net/bluetooth/l2cap_core.c b/net/bluetooth/l2cap_core.c
index 37736c6..63539f9 100644
--- a/net/bluetooth/l2cap_core.c
+++ b/net/bluetooth/l2cap_core.c
@@ -2720,7 +2720,8 @@ static inline int l2cap_connect_rsp(struct l2cap_conn *conn, struct l2cap_cmd_hd
 	result = __le16_to_cpu(rsp->result);
 	status = __le16_to_cpu(rsp->status);
 
-	BT_DBG("dcid 0x%4.4x scid 0x%4.4x result 0x%2.2x status 0x%2.2x", dcid, scid, result, status);
+	BT_DBG("dcid 0x%4.4x scid 0x%4.4x result 0x%2.2x status 0x%2.2x",
+						dcid, scid, result, status);
 
 	if (scid) {
 		chan = l2cap_get_chan_by_scid(conn, scid);
-- 
1.7.9
